Question 8.3
Two identical cylindrical rollers are installed onto fixed rotation axes aligned parallel within a horizontal plane. The distance between the axes is 2l. A uniform board of mass m is placed onto the rollers. The coefficient of kinetic friction between the rollers and the board is . Suppose that the centre of mass of the board is displaced from the central position between the rollers by a small distance of x.(a) Find the normal force acting on the board by each cylindrical roller.
(b) The rollers are driven by external rotors to rotate at uniform angular speeds in directions shown in the figure. Show that the motion of the board is a harmonic oscillation and find its period.
